The way Team India captain Rohit Sharma has batted has proved to be a game changer in the ICC T20 World Cup 2024. Rohit has led the team from the front and has scored the most runs for India in this T20 World Cup so far. Team India may get a chance to play at least one and maximum two matches in ICC T20 World Cup 2024. Indian team has reached the semi-final and if they win the semi-final then they will play the final match. If Rohit Sharma hits 11 sixes in these two matches (two matches if India reach the final), he will set the world record for most sixes in T20 and ODI World Cups. Currently, this world record is held by former West Indies opening batsman Chris Gayle.

T20 and ODIs World Cup Overall, Chris Gayle has hit a total of 112 sixes between 2003 and 2021, while Rohit Sharma has hit a total of 102 sixes between 2007 and 2024. Gayle and Rohit are the only two batsmen to have hit more than 100 sixes in a World Cup together. Third in the list is Australia’s David Warner who has hit a total of 81 sixes between 2009 and 2024. At number four is Australia’s Glenn Maxwell who has hit 73 sixes between 2012 and 2024.

At number five is South Africa’s AB de Villiers, who has hit a total of 67 sixes between 2007 and 2016. Rohit Sharma is the only Indian in the top-10 in this list while Virat Kohli is at number 12. Virat Kohli has hit 46 sixes between 2011 and 2024. Rohit Sharma hit eight sixes in Team India’s last Super-8 match against Australia and the way he is in form, he can break Gayle’s record.
